Buhari Appoints Tutuwa as FIIRO Boss

By Mohammed Mohammed

President Muhammadu Buhari on Wednesday approved the appointment of Dr. Jummai Adamu Tutuwa, as the substantive Director General (DG) of Federal Institute of Industrial Research, Oshodi (FIIRO) Lagos with effect from 10th May.

Tutuwa takes over from Dr. Agnes Asagbra, who saddled with the management of FIIRO since February 2020 till date.

The Deputy Director, Press/Public Relations, Mr. Atuora Obiora, in a statement, said Tutuwa, prior to her appointment, was the Director in charge of the Biotechnology Centre at National Biotechnology Development Agency (NABDA), Jalingo Taraba State.
